Output 8051f26f9cb15ec0fb4bb545dc6002ff28b2334f6d534c8fb1d73a265bd80fd4:0

value
1684806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61bc5a302fec20581282b43b67fe6f7462b2e419 OP_EQUAL
address
3Abo76fDWKW2ufrS2TTLKUtu2gVxqt8GrW
transaction
8051f26f9cb15ec0fb4bb545dc6002ff28b2334f6d534c8fb1d73a265bd80fd4
confirmations
394970
spent
true